Young puppies should be interacted socially
Three-to-fourteen-week-old puppies are the very best age to reveal them to new experiences. It's important to make certain they remain in a risk-free setting with individuals that can handle them. They must be allowed to check out your house and meet a selection of people. If they are hung out, they will certainly be much less worried regarding individuals who are unknown to them later on in life. It's additionally a good idea to present them to children, but keep in mind to check their practices and interactions.
Invite close friends with healthy, vaccinated pets over to play and connect with your pups. You can likewise sign up with a pup course, but be sure to discover one that is well-controlled. If you observe any kind of fearful or avoidance behaviors, reduce the level of sound and task. Reestablish the thing, person, or object at a lower strength and repeat as needed. If your puppy comes to be overloaded, stop the interaction and distract them with a toy. If you have a delicate pup, you might require to speak with a habits expert.
Young puppies need to be potty trained
The very best method to train young puppies for young puppy childcare is to make sure they are potty qualified and familiar with a routine. Taking them outside consistently will help them learn to control their bladders and bowels. This is especially essential in young puppies, who have little bladders and require constant trips to the shower room. Various other hints that a young puppy requires to go outdoors consist of sniffing the flooring board dog training near me or carpet, wandering around your home, getting overexcited during playtime, or whimpering.
Whenever you take your puppy outside to eliminate, constantly accompany them on a chain. This will certainly show them that the elimination area is a different task from outdoors play time and will certainly make it most likely that they will get rid of rapidly. Once they have gotten rid of, award them with praise and a treat.
Remember to avoid penalty and abuse when they have mishaps. They will be confused by your reactions and might be more probable to duplicate the habits in the future.
